Load gallery from database

I found a solution, but unfortunately it’s not a clean one. Perhaps, anyone can tell me how to define the array correctly :slight_smile:

if(photosUploaded > 0) {

$w('#galleryPhotosUploaded').items = [];
let photosToShow = [{
"type":         "image",
"description":  photosUploadedItems[0].description,
"title":        'Photo téléchargé par ' + photosUploadedItems[0].uploadedby,
"src":          photosUploadedItems[0].photo
}]

for (let i = 1; i < photosUploaded; i++) {
photosToShow.push ({
"type":         "image",
"description":  photosUploadedItems[i].description,
"title":        'Photo téléchargé par ' + photosUploadedItems[i].uploadedby,
"src":          photosUploadedItems[i].photo
})
}
console.log(photosToShow);
$w('#galleryPhotosUploaded').items = photosToShow;
}